Responsibilities
- Development of customer-facing applications from design through implementation.
- Act in a technical leadership capacity- Mentoring junior engineers, new team members.
- Resolve defects/bugs during QA testing, pre-production, production, and post-release patches.
- Work cross-functionally with various teams: product management, QA/QE, various product lines, or business units to drive forward results.
- Contribute to the design and architecture of the project.
Required Skills
- Full stack suite applications involving UI (Angular React), Microservices and Backend technologies with Java8.
- Solid communication skills.
- Demonstrate ability to explain complex technical issues to both technical and non-technical audiences.
- Strong understand of the Software design/architecture process.
- Passion for grow and apply technical skills in service to customers.
Required Experience
- Should have more than 6 years of IT experience in Full Stack JavaJ2EE.
- Experience in Databases Oracle Postgres Couchbase.
- Experience with Agile Development, SCRUM, or Extreme Programming methodologies qualifications.
- 7+ years experience developing web applications using Java.
Education Requirements
- Bachelor’s Degree in Computer Science, Information Technology or a closely related field.